Поделиться через


WebSocketContext Класс

Определение

Используется для доступа к сведениям в подтверждении WebSocket.

public ref class WebSocketContext abstract
public abstract class WebSocketContext
type WebSocketContext = class
Public MustInherit Class WebSocketContext
Наследование
WebSocketContext
Производный

Конструкторы

WebSocketContext()

Создает экземпляр класса WebSocketContext.

Свойства

CookieCollection

Файлы cookie, переданные на сервер во время начала установления связи.

Headers

Заголовки HTTP, отправленные на сервер во время начала установления связи.

IsAuthenticated

Прошел ли клиент WebSocket проверку подлинности.

IsLocal

Подключен ли клиент WebSocket с локального компьютера.

IsSecureConnection

Защищается ли соединение WebSocket с помощью протокола SSL.

Origin

Значение HTTP-заголовка Origin, включенного в начало установления связи.

RequestUri

URI, запрашиваемый клиентом WebSocket.

SecWebSocketKey

Значение HTTP-заголовка SecWebSocketKey, включенного в начало установления связи.

SecWebSocketProtocols

Значение HTTP-заголовка SecWebSocketKey, включенного в начало установления связи.

SecWebSocketVersion

Список подпротоколов, запрошенных клиентом WebSocket.

User

Объект, используемый для получения удостоверения, сведений проверки подлинности и ролей безопасности для клиента WebSocket.

WebSocket

Экземпляр WebSocket, используемый для взаимодействия (отправка, получение, закрытие и т. д.) с соединением WebSocket.

Методы

Equals(Object)

Определяет, равен ли указанный объект текущему объекту.

(Унаследовано от Object)
GetHashCode()

Служит хэш-функцией по умолчанию.

(Унаследовано от Object)
GetType()

Возвращает объект Type для текущего экземпляра.

(Унаследовано от Object)
MemberwiseClone()

Создает неполную копию текущего объекта Object.

(Унаследовано от Object)
ToString()

Возвращает строку, представляющую текущий объект.

(Унаследовано от Object)

Применяется к